Public transportation accidents are a notable concern alongside private vehicle mishaps. The Federal Government oversees carriers transporting passengers and cargo across state boundaries, while individual states regulate systems within their borders. This structure allows for coordinated management of both interstate and intrastate transportation.
What Are Common Carriers?
Common carriers are entities offering transportation services to the public for a fee. These include buses, trains, ferries, and airplanes. Some exceptions apply, especially concerning certain airplane types and private charters. Recognizing a common carrier is crucial for applying specific regulations in each state. These regulations cover equipment, licensing, operating procedures, fares, and more, benefiting both the transportation industry and the public.
Liability and Safety Standards
The Federal Government has established regulations defining the liability of common carriers for passenger injuries. State laws further determine the extent of liability, with many following the principle that common carriers are responsible for injuries sustained by passengers. This is based on the expectation that carriers must exercise the highest care and diligence in their operations and maintain equipment to ensure passenger safety.
In some states, regulations do not entirely hold carriers responsible for passenger safety but mandate a high degree of care. Generally, if an accident could have been avoided with proper care, the carrier is held accountable.
